Blunt Eye Trauma
Blunt eye trauma — from a fist, ball, airbag, or fall — compresses the globe without breaching its wall, and the resulting damage can involve nearly every structure of the eye at once. The medical-legal challenge is twofold: some consequences appear immediately and heal, while others, most notably angle-recession glaucoma, may not declare themselves for years. Sound causation and damages opinions therefore depend on longitudinal follow-up, not just the emergency-room snapshot.

How Blunt Force Injures the Eye
A blunt impact briefly compresses the globe front-to-back and expands it side-to-side. That mechanical distortion shears the delicate structures inside: the iris root, the fine fibers suspending the lens, the drainage angle, the retina, and the choroid beneath it. One blow can therefore produce a constellation of findings, and the documented pattern should be internally consistent with a compressive mechanism — a consistency check that is part of any careful review, as discussed on the ocular trauma expert witness hub page.
The Characteristic Sequelae
- Hyphema — blood in the anterior chamber, the space between cornea and iris. Usually resolves, but signals significant force and marks the eye for angle injury; rebleeding and pressure spikes are the acute management issues.
- Angle recession — a tear within the eye's internal drainage angle, visible on gonioscopy (examination of the angle with a mirrored contact lens). It matters because extensive recession predisposes to late-onset glaucoma, sometimes years or decades after the injury.
- Iridodialysis — separation of the iris root from its attachment, producing an irregular pupil and often glare complaints.
- Traumatic cataract and lens dislocation — clouding of the natural lens, or its displacement when the suspending fibers tear; either may require surgery whose complexity exceeds routine cataract surgery.
- Commotio retinae — retinal whitening from the shock wave. Often transient, but foveal involvement can leave permanent central-vision deficit.
- Choroidal rupture — a tear in the vascular layer beneath the retina; when it crosses near the macula, permanent central vision loss can result, and late complications can arise at the rupture site.
- Orbital fracture — breakage of the thin bones around the eye, with possible double vision from muscle entrapment or a sunken appearance; associated globe injury must always be excluded.
Records and Examination Components
The acute record should contain presenting visual acuity, pressure measurements, and a dilated fundus examination; the follow-up record should contain gonioscopy once the eye quiets — angle recession cannot be documented without it — plus serial pressures, OCT (optical coherence tomography, cross-sectional retinal imaging) of the macula where central vision is at issue, and photographs. Pre-incident records remain essential: cataracts and glaucoma also occur without trauma, and the pre-injury baseline is the anchor for attribution.
Causation and the Long Tail of Blunt Trauma
The signature causation problem here is latency. A claimant may develop glaucoma five, ten, or twenty years after a documented hyphema; whether that glaucoma is traumatic turns on the documented angle findings, the asymmetry between the two eyes, and the exclusion of ordinary open-angle glaucoma, which is common in the general population. Conversely, a cataract appearing in a sixty-year-old three years after a minor contusion may owe more to age than to injury. Key point: Blunt trauma's most serious consequences can be delayed by years. Longitudinal records — especially gonioscopy findings and serial pressures — often decide whether a late condition is traumatic or coincidental.
What an Evaluation Can and Cannot Determine
An examination years after injury can document current structure and function with precision, and permanent findings such as angle recession or a choroidal rupture scar are durable evidence of past trauma. What no examination can do is retroactively establish findings that were never recorded — if gonioscopy was never performed, the angle status at the time of injury is simply unknown, and the opinion must carry that uncertainty honestly.
What Attorneys Should Provide
Emergency records, all subsequent ophthalmology and optometry records including gonioscopy notes and pressure logs, imaging and photographs in native form, pre-incident eye records going back as far as available, and a description of the mechanism (object, distance, protective eyewear). Frequently Asked Questions
What is angle recession and why does it matter in litigation?
Angle recession is a tear within the eye's internal drainage structure caused by blunt trauma, detectable on gonioscopy. It matters because extensive recession predisposes to glaucoma that may not appear for years or decades, making it a frequent link — or claimed link — between an old injury and later vision loss.
Can glaucoma diagnosed years after an eye injury be caused by that injury?
It can be. Traumatic angle damage can produce glaucoma long after the original injury. Attribution depends on documented angle recession, asymmetry between the injured and uninjured eye, and exclusion of ordinary open-angle glaucoma, which is common without any trauma. The follow-up record usually decides the question.
Is a traumatic cataract different from an age-related cataract?
Blunt trauma can cloud the lens in patterns ophthalmologists recognize as traumatic, and injury can also displace the lens by tearing its supporting fibers. In older claimants the analysis must separate injury effect from age-related change, using the pre-incident records and the comparison with the fellow eye.
